Table 1.
Characteristics of each vessel type classified in this study.
Vessel types classified in this study | |||
---|---|---|---|
Artery | Arteriole | Sinusoid | |
Vascular markers | |||
CD31 (IHC, FCM) | + | + | + |
VE-cadherin (FCM) | + | + | + |
AF633 (IVI, IHC) | + | − | − |
α-SMA (IHC) | + | − | − |
NG2 (IHC) | + | + | Low/− |
Sca-1 (IVI, IHC, FCM) | + | + | Low |
AcLDL (IVI, FCM) | − | − | + |
Podoplanin (FCM) | − | − | + |
Vessel typesthat are considered identical in previous reports | |||
Bixel et al., Cell Reports, 2017 (Skull bone) | Arterial vessel | Arterial vessel | Post-arterial / Intermediate / Sinusoidal capillaries |
Itkin et al., Nature, 2016 (Long bone) | Artery | Endosteal arterioles | Sinusoid |
Acar et al., Nature, 2015 (Long bone) | Arteriole | TZ vessel | Sinusoid |
Kusumbe et al., Nature, 2015 (Long bone) | Artery | Arteriole | Type H/L capillary |
